What does 5 mean on plastic containers?
The number 5 with the recycling symbol indicates polypropylene, often just shortened to PP. The resin identification code for polypropylene, commonly known as number 5 plastic. This plastic type is particularly hard and heat resistant.Is 5 plastic microwave safe?
If they container has a #5 on it, it is made from polypropylene, PP, so it is generally considered microwave safe.Can I dishwash #5 plastic?

Is 5 recycle number safe?
Select safe plastics for food storage.Only use plastic containers with the recycling #1, #2, #4 and #5 for food storage. Consider switching to glass storage containers since plastic containers can leach chemicals into the environment and your food as they age and become used.
What does 5 mean in recycling?
5: PP (Polypropylene)PP is used to make the food containers used for products like yogurt, sour cream and margarine. It's also made into straws, rope, carpet and bottle caps. PP products CAN SOMETIMES be recycled.

Is polypropylene toxic to humans?
Polypropylene (PP) is usually considered safe for humans. It is considered the safest of all plastics; it is a robust heat-resistant plastic. Because of its high heat tolerance, it is unlikely to leach even when exposed to warm or hot water. It is approved for use with food and beverage storage.Should you wash plastic containers before use?
